MOURADOFF Léon (1893-1980)
Armenian School of Paris
Bronze sculpture with brown patina: THE BANDONE PLAYER
Height: 53 cm
Period "lost-wax" casting with brown patina, dated 1932, in perfect condition.
Foundry mark of the SUSSE Brothers and signature of the artist.
Three of his works are held at the Armenian Museum in Paris,
To date, 22 of his works have been auctioned; the oldest concerns the work "Bust of Beethoven" presented in 1990 and the most recent concerns "The Family" sold in 2022.
His works are generally, as is the case here, influenced by Antoine Bourdelle, whose student he was.
